SACRAMENTO --
The California State Board of Equalization announced Tuesday its list of largest unpaid tax delinquencies. The list totals $72 million in unpaid sales and use taxes.
Jerome Horton, vice chairperson of the state board, wrote an assembly bill in 2006 that publicizes the list every year as a way of prompting payment by the list's biggest offenders.
